Google unveiled partnership with iFixit to equip Pixel phones with DIY repair kits 

According to the latest report, Google and iFixit have signed an agreement that will ensure that nearly all existing Pixel series smartphones and all upcoming Pixel devices will come with DIY (do-it-yourself) repair kits. iFixit.com will sell Google phone parts individually and in kits later this year.

Google has confirmed its support for the “Right to Repair” campaign and has partnered with iFixit to launch a self-repair program for Pixel users. iFixit announced in a blog post that they will be rolling out the Pixel Self Repair Program in summer 2022. The Self Repair Program and its components will be available in the US, UK, Canada, Australia, and EU countries.

Moreover, the program will provide key components such as the battery, camera, and display, as well as common parts for repairing Pixel smartphones, which will be available separately. Pixel users who haven’t done DIY repairs will need to purchase these components as part of a “repair kit.”

Furthermore, iFixit’s Pixel device repair kit will come with all the tools needed for repairs, including a screwdriver, spudger, and iOpener. The iOpener is a calibrated heating device designed to apply heat directly and evenly to the parts of the phone that are joined by an adhesive.

The kit will also include an adhesive for re-waterproofing the phone, a set of six opening picks, an iFixit opening tool, suction cups, beveled tweezers, and a precision drill bit tool with an integrated SIM eject tool, and 4mm precision drill bits designed for specific models.

Google has said that all future Pixel series smartphones will be automatically included in the self-repair program. In addition, Google is offering five years of security updates for the latest Pixel 6 series devices to help extend the life of Pixel smartphones.
